A note on the effect of immunostimulation of laying hens on the lysozyme activity in egg white
2003
Swierczewska, E. | Niemiec, J. | Noworyta-Glowacka, J. (Warsaw Agricultural University (Poland). Dept. of Poultry Breeding)
Four immunostimulating preparations (IPs) - Levamisol, Lidium KLP,, Echinacea and Baymix Se+E were administered to Hy-line hens aged 8 months. The egg white lysozyme activity (LA) was determined before administering the IP, and next 17, 24, 31, 45 and 60 dys after. All IPs led to an increase in the egg white LA which was maintained over a period of 45 and even 60 days after administration. Levamisol was shown to be most effective IP, while Baymix Se+E the least
